West Ham fans are not pleased with Cresswell after Arsenal defeat

Aaron Cresswell started at left-back for West Ham against Arsenal and many fans don’t want to see much more of him.

The Hammers fell to a 1-0 defeat at the Emirates Stadium last Saturday, with some fans blaming Cresswell for Alexandre Lacazette’s winner with 12 minutes remaining.

The statistics seem to show that the Englishman had a pretty steady game up against Nicolas Pepe.

The 30-year-old made two interceptions, two clearances and blocked two shots, whilst also not committing a single foul in the 90 minutes (WhoScored).

Cresswell has been a regular at the back for the Hammers and seems to be one of David Moyes’ favourite players at the club, proven by the fact that he has played every minute of top-flight action since he took over as manager of the club (Transfermarkt).
